La herramienta de monitoreo de Elasticsearch de Applications Manager reune datos KPI críticos y le proporciona información actualizada sobre las operaciones subyacentes en su cluster de trabajo. Con la herramienta de monitoreo de Elasticsearch de Applications Manager puede:
Elasticsearch suele implementarse como un cluster de nodos. Con el monitoreo del servidor de Elasticsearch de Applications Manager, obtega varias métricas específicas del cluster, como detalles de los nodos, de los fragmentos y datos de los índices. Garantice un rendimiento óptimo de los clusters de Elasticsearch controlando los componentes clave, como las métricas del estado de salud de Elasticsearch, las métricas del tiempo de ejecución del cluster, las métricas de los nodos individuales, los hilos de procesos en tiempo real y las configuraciones.
Comprenda la utilización de los recursos con la ayuda de la herramienta de monitoreo de Elasticsearch de Applications Manager, donde puede visualizar las métricas clave del estado de salud de Elasticsearch, como la disponibilidad, la CPU, la carga y los detalles de la memoria de los clusters de Elasticsearch. Conozca cuando necesita añadir capacidad de disco a los nodos existentes o volver a fragmentar para agregar más nodos. Esta herramienta de supervisión también le alerta de los cambios en el consumo de recursos de las colas del pool de hilos de procesos.
Manténgase al tanto del estado de salud de su cluster monitoreando métricas críticas como:
Nuestro monitoreo de Elasticsearch le permite rastrear el uso de la memoria del cluster del servidor de Elasticsearch para obtener información sobre la cantidad de memoria JVM heap que se está utilizando actualmente en comparación con la memoria comprometida. Identifique cambios inusuales como un pico repentino en la tasa actual de búsqueda, solicitudes de indexación, etc y tome medidas correctivas rápidas antes de que afecten la experiencia del usuario final.
Desmitifique el monitoreo de aplicaciones de Elasticsearch actualizando efectivamente los índices con nueva información cada vez que la carga de trabajo sea de escritura intensiva. Obtenga un control total de sus índices y mapeos con esta herramienta de monitoreo. Supervise métricas como la latencia media de las consultas en cada nodo, el tiempo medio de los segmentos en el nodo, el uso de la caché del sistema de archivos, las tasas de solicitud, etc. y tome medidas si se violan los umbrales.
Al realizar el monitoreo de la salud de Elasticsearch, es fundamental mantener a raya los problemas de rendimiento causados por el alto tráfico de la red. Los nodos de Elasticsearch utilizan pools de hilos de procesos para gestionar el consumo de memoria y CPU de los hilos de procesos. Los problemas del pool de hilos de procesos pueden ser causados por un gran número de solicitudes pendientes o por un solo nodo lento, así como por el rechazo de un grupo de hilos de procesos. Monitoree el pool de hilos sensibles como los de: search, index, merge y bulk para adelantarse a los problemas que puedan surgir.
Aunque existen herramientas dedicadas a la supervisión de Elasticsearch, se necesita una solución de monitoreo más compleja como Applications Manager para supervisar el rendimiento de Elasticsearch en el contexto del resto de la infraestructura. Además de Elasticsearch, puede supervisar el rendimiento y la experiencia de usuario de más de 150 aplicaciones y elementos de infraestructura con Applications Manager.
Ahorre tiempo y esfuerzo descubriendo automáticamente los nodos de Elasticsearch, haciendo un seguimiento de las métricas importantes y configurando facilmente las alertas a través nuestros dashboards de Elasticsearch.
Mantener el funcionamiento óptimo de Elasticsearch puede ser vital, especialmente para las aplicaciones que afectan a los usuarios finales o a las operaciones a escala. ¡Para que pruebe usted mismo, Descargue una prueba gratuita de 30 días ahora!.